Continuous operation
In continuous operation mode, the device dehumidifies the air
constantly, regardless of the humidity.
Note:
For continuous operation mode the condensation drain hose
should be connected in order to continuously drain the
accumulating condensate.
1. Press the CONT. button (25) to switch continuous operation
on or off.
ð With activated continuous operation mode the CONT.
LED (15) is illuminated.
Laundry drying function
The device may be used to dry clothes in a more timely manner.
When positioning the device or a clothes horse, please observe
the minimum distances specified in the technical data.
1. Press the TURBO button (24) to set the maximum fan stage
(stage 2).
ð The TURBO LED (16) is illuminated.
ð The function for drying laundry is activated.
Comfort mode
Comfort mode ensures an agreeable humidity level ranging
between 45 % and 55 %. Depending on the room temperature
the device automatically regulates the convenient humidity level
choosing a value from 45%-50%-55%.
In this operating mode it is not possible to regulate the humidity
level manually.
1. Press the COMFORT button (27) to switch comfort mode on
or off.

Operation with hose attached to the condensation
connection
For a continuous dehumidification (continuous operation mode)
the condensation drain hose should be connected to the device.
ü The hose included in the scope of delivery is ready for use.
ü The hose adapter included in the scope of delivery is ready
for use.
ü The device is switched off.
1. Unscrew the sealing cap from the connection.
2. Screw the hose adapter (5) onto the connection.
3. Push one end of the hose onto the hose adapter.
